Front Royal, Virginia, is a small town nestled in the Shenandoah Mountains with a rich history dating back to 1788. Known for its natural beauty, the town offers ample opportunities for outdoor activities such as hiking, mountain climbing, spelunking, and boating on the Shenandoah River. Front Royal is part of Virginia Wine Country, featuring several vineyards and wineries, and retains historic taverns from the Civil War era. The town is the county seat of Warren County and has a population of around 15,000. Many residents commute to major employers in the Washington, D.C. Metro area, about 70 miles east, or work in local manufacturing jobs. Skyline Drive, a scenic parkway through Shenandoah National Park, and the Appalachian Trail are major attractions, offering numerous things to do like picnicking, hiking, and mountain biking. Eastham Park provides river access for fishing, kayaking, and canoeing, while Shenandoah River State Park offers camping and water sports. Skyline Caverns, located 2 miles south, features ancient subterranean formations. The town's revitalized Main Street boasts restaurants, shops, and antique stores, including the historic Chester Street Tavern. Front Royal hosts events like the Festival of Leaves and the Appaloosa music fest. The town experiences four distinct seasons and averages 22 inches of snow annually. Despite a moderate flood risk due to its proximity to the Shenandoah River, Front Royal remains safer than the national average in terms of crime. The nearest major airport is Dulles International Airport, 60 miles away.
